Adaptogens would make a wonderful tea for your husband, since they help the body and mind hold up under stress. (They have a tonic effect on the body and are safe for most people.) Read the July 2009 article "Energize with Eleuthero." We have an easy method for combining the mild adaptogen eleuthero (Eleutherococcus senticosus) with a smoothie. For a tea, you might try American ginseng (Panax quinquefolius) with ginger (Zingiber officinalis) added to improve the taste. Reishi (Ganoderma lucidum), rhodiola (Rhodiola rosea) and ashwaganda (Withania somnifera) are other adaptogens that have a calming effect and may be helpful. While these herbs are generally safe, it’s always best to check with a health-care provider before using, especially if your husband takes any prescription medications. —Eds.
